Calculating 3000 Days in Years

To determine how many years are in 3000 days, we need to understand the basic conversion between days and years. A standard year is considered to have 365 days. However, it's important to note that a year can also be 366 days during a leap year. For simplicity, we will use the standard 365-day year for this calculation.

Here is the calculation:

3000 days ÷ 365 days/year = approximately 8.22 years

So, 3000 days is roughly equivalent to 8.22 years. This calculation is based on the assumption that there are no leap years within the 3000-day period. If leap years are considered, the exact number of years would be slightly different.

Time Measurement in Different Cultures

Time measurement is not uniform across all cultures. Different societies have developed their own systems for measuring time, often based on their unique needs and traditions. For example:

  • Western Calendar: The Gregorian calendar, widely used in the Western world, divides time into years, months, and days. It is based on the solar year and includes leap years to account for the Earth's orbit around the sun.
  • Lunar Calendar: Some cultures, such as those in the Middle East and parts of Asia, use a lunar calendar. This calendar is based on the phases of the moon and has 12 months, each lasting approximately 29 or 30 days.
  • Lunisolar Calendar: The Chinese calendar is a lunisolar calendar, which means it is based on both the solar year and the lunar month. It includes leap months to keep the calendar in sync with the solar year.

These different systems highlight the diversity in time measurement and the cultural significance of time.

Historical Context of Time Measurement

The measurement of time has evolved over centuries, with various civilizations developing their own methods and tools. Here is a brief overview of the historical context of time measurement:

  • Ancient Civilizations: Early civilizations, such as the Egyptians and Babylonians, used astronomical observations to measure time. They developed calendars based on the movements of the sun, moon, and stars.
  • Middle Ages: During the Middle Ages, the Julian calendar was introduced by Julius Caesar. This calendar was based on the solar year and included leap years to account for the Earth's orbit.
  • Modern Era: The Gregorian calendar, introduced by Pope Gregory XIII in 1582, is the most widely used calendar today. It includes adjustments to the Julian calendar to better align with the solar year.

These historical developments have shaped our understanding of time and its measurement, providing a foundation for modern timekeeping.
